news 2026/6/10 16:50:48

终极AutoHotkey键盘速度优化完整指南:如何彻底提升自动化脚本响应性能

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极AutoHotkey键盘速度优化完整指南:如何彻底提升自动化脚本响应性能

终极AutoHotkey键盘速度优化完整指南:如何彻底提升自动化脚本响应性能

【免费下载链接】AutoHotkey项目地址: https://gitcode.com/gh_mirrors/autohotke/AutoHotkey

AutoHotkey作为Windows平台上最强大的自动化脚本工具,其键盘响应速度直接决定了自动化效率。通过精准调整键盘延迟参数,用户可以让脚本执行速度提升300%以上,彻底告别卡顿和响应延迟问题。

🎯 键盘响应优化的核心价值

键盘响应优化不仅仅是技术层面的调整,更是提升工作效率的关键手段。一个经过优化的AutoHotkey脚本能够:

  • 实现毫秒级响应,让自动化操作行云流水
  • 避免按键冲突和事件丢失,确保操作可靠性
  • 适应不同应用场景,从文本处理到游戏操作都能游刃有余

🔧 三大关键延迟参数深度解析

在AutoHotkey的底层架构中,有三个核心参数控制着键盘行为的时序:

基础延迟控制

  • 默认按键间隔:控制连续按键之间的等待时间
  • 按下持续时间:决定单个按键按下和释放的间隔
  • 播放模式延迟:针对特殊场景的专用延迟设置

这些参数在项目的source/globaldata.h文件中定义,通过keyboard_mouse.cpp模块实现精确的时序管理。

⚡ 四类应用场景优化方案

办公文档处理加速

对于大量文本输入场景,推荐采用极速模式:

SetKeyDelay, -1

这种设置能够跳过所有人为延迟,实现最快的文本输入速度。

游戏自动化优化

游戏环境对键盘响应有特殊要求,建议配置:

SetKeyDelay, 10, 50, Play

这种组合在保证稳定性的同时提供最佳响应速度。

界面操作自动化

GUI自动化需要平衡速度和准确性:

SetKeyDelay, 5, 15, Input

精确控制场景

需要精细控制的场景:

SetKeyDelay, 0, 5, Event

🚀 性能调优实战技巧

延迟参数黄金配比表

使用场景基础延迟按下时长发送模式
文本快速输入-110Event
游戏操作10-2030-50Play
界面自动化515Input
精密控制05Event

智能模式选择策略

SendInput模式

  • 优势:系统级输入,延迟最小
  • 适用:大多数日常自动化任务

SendPlay模式

  • 优势:游戏兼容性好
  • 适用:游戏内自动化操作

SendEvent模式

  • 优势:完全可控的传统模式
  • 适用:需要精确时序控制的场景

💡 常见问题解决方案

按键事件丢失处理

当遇到按键事件丢失时,可以:

  • 适当增加PressDuration参数
  • 检查目标应用程序的焦点状态
  • 考虑系统当前的负载情况

响应不稳定优化

如果脚本响应时快时慢:

  • 统一使用同一种发送模式
  • 避免在脚本中混合使用不同延迟设置
  • 确保没有其他程序干扰键盘输入

🛠️ 高级调试与监控

通过深入分析键盘事件处理机制,可以进一步优化性能:

  • 监控按键事件队列状态
  • 分析事件处理时序图
  • 跟踪延迟统计信息

📈 优化效果评估标准

一个成功的键盘响应优化应该达到:

  • 脚本执行时间减少50%以上
  • 操作成功率接近100%
  • 在不同系统环境下表现稳定

🎉 最佳实践总结

AutoHotkey键盘响应优化是一个系统工程,需要根据具体使用场景灵活调整。记住以下关键原则:

  1. 测试驱动优化:在实际使用环境中验证每种设置
  2. 渐进式调整:从小数值开始逐步优化
  • 环境适配:考虑目标软件的特性和系统当前状态
  • 持续监控:定期检查脚本性能表现

通过掌握这些优化技巧,您的AutoHotkey脚本将实现质的飞跃,无论是办公效率提升还是游戏自动化,都能获得极致的性能体验。

【免费下载链接】AutoHotkey项目地址: https://gitcode.com/gh_mirrors/autohotke/AutoHotkey

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/6 5:20:44

RS-LoRA动态路由微调机制探究

RS-LoRA动态路由微调机制探究 在大模型落地的现实场景中,一个核心矛盾日益凸显:我们既希望模型具备强大的任务适应能力,又无法承受全参数微调带来的高昂成本。尤其是在企业级AI系统中,面对不断新增的业务线、快速迭代的需求和有限…

作者头像 李华
网站建设 2026/6/5 22:55:01

Itsycal终极指南:打造高效的菜单栏日历体验

Itsycal终极指南:打造高效的菜单栏日历体验 【免费下载链接】Itsycal Itsycal is a tiny calendar for your Macs menu bar. http://www.mowglii.com/itsycal 项目地址: https://gitcode.com/gh_mirrors/it/Itsycal Mac日历应用的选择往往决定了您的工作效率…

作者头像 李华
网站建设 2026/6/10 13:08:55

Moq框架完整指南:.NET单元测试的终极解决方案

Moq框架完整指南:.NET单元测试的终极解决方案 【免费下载链接】moq The most popular and friendly mocking framework for .NET 项目地址: https://gitcode.com/gh_mirrors/moq4/moq4 Moq作为.NET生态中最流行、最友好的模拟框架,为开发者提供了…

作者头像 李华
网站建设 2026/6/10 15:53:51

LOOT模组管理大师:告别游戏崩溃,轻松优化加载顺序

LOOT模组管理大师:告别游戏崩溃,轻松优化加载顺序 【免费下载链接】loot A modding utility for Starfield and some Elder Scrolls and Fallout games. 项目地址: https://gitcode.com/gh_mirrors/lo/loot LOOT(Load Order Optimizat…

作者头像 李华
网站建设 2026/6/10 13:07:21

Clangd终极指南:如何为你的C++项目配置智能代码补全

Clangd终极指南:如何为你的C项目配置智能代码补全 【免费下载链接】clangd clangd language server 项目地址: https://gitcode.com/gh_mirrors/cl/clangd Clangd是一个强大的C语言服务器,能够为各种编辑器提供IDE级别的智能代码补全、错误诊断和…

作者头像 李华
网站建设 2026/6/10 13:11:06

GoMusic终极指南:轻松实现跨平台歌单迁移完整教程

GoMusic终极指南:轻松实现跨平台歌单迁移完整教程 【免费下载链接】GoMusic 迁移网易云/QQ音乐歌单至 Apple/Youtube/Spotify Music 项目地址: https://gitcode.com/gh_mirrors/go/GoMusic 还在为更换音乐平台时歌单无法迁移而烦恼吗?GoMusic项目…

作者头像 李华